Mobilize cities with more affordable, cleaner, and safer solution. Our solution is an on-demand microtransit that is half the price of other ride-hailing through sharing. We use electric vehicles designed specifically for sharing (design-patented), as well as dynamic-route sharing that helps reducing operating cost by 30%. We have served 4,000,000+ passengers with 350+ EVs and this is just the beginning. We are shaping the future of mobility, so join us to scale the impact!
